At Broadwood School

We put our KS1 to KS5 pupils at the centre of how we work and have created a school that is welcoming, caring, safe, nurturing and warm. We see strong relationships with our children and young people, parents, carers and the wider community as the key to our success.

We develop our pupils’ social and emotional resilience by having clear boundaries which pupils are supported to thrive within. The school uses a restorative approach to conflict which allows pupils to quickly reintegrate into their learning. Within newly introduced nurturing room, we have a variety of methodical approaches to help calm students down from Lego Therapy to our sensory sandpit.
